The Importance of Responsive Web Design in Today's Mobile-First World

As more and more people use mobile devices for online browsing, it's become increasingly important for websites to be optimized for mobile. One of the best ways to achieve this is through responsive web design, which allows websites to adapt to different screen sizes and devices.

In this article, we'll explore the benefits of responsive web design and why it's so important in today's mobile-first world.

Benefits of Responsive Web Design

Responsive web design offers several benefits, including:

  1. Improved user experience on mobile devices: By optimizing your website for mobile devices, you can provide a better user experience for mobile users. This can lead to increased engagement, higher conversion rates, and happier customers.

  2. Increased mobile traffic and engagement: With more and more people using mobile devices to access the internet, having a mobile-friendly website is crucial for attracting and retaining visitors. By using responsive design, you can ensure that your website looks great on all devices and encourages mobile users to stay on your site longer.

  3. Better search engine optimization (SEO) through mobile responsiveness: Responsive web design can also improve your search engine rankings, as Google has indicated that mobile-friendly websites are given preference in search results. By ensuring that your website is optimized for mobile devices, you can improve your SEO and attract more organic traffic to your site.

Best Practices for Responsive Web Design

To achieve the benefits of responsive web design, it's important to follow some best practices, such as:

  1. Use of flexible and adaptable layouts: A key aspect of responsive design is the use of flexible and adaptable layouts that can adjust to different screen sizes and resolutions.

  2. Optimization of images and media for different screen sizes: To ensure that your website looks great on all devices, it's important to optimize images and media for different screen sizes.

  3. Implementation of mobile-friendly navigation and menus: Mobile users have different needs than desktop users, so it's important to have mobile-friendly navigation and menus that make it easy for users to find what they're looking for.

  4. Integration of mobile-specific features, such as click-to-call buttons: By integrating mobile-specific features like click-to-call buttons, you can make it easier for mobile users to contact your business and engage with your content.

Impact of Responsive Web Design on SEO

Responsive web design can have a significant impact on your search engine rankings, as Google has indicated that mobile-friendly websites are given preference in search results. In addition, responsive design can improve website speed and load times, which are important factors in SEO.

Responsive web design is also important for local SEO and Google My Business listings, as Google uses location data to provide users with relevant search results. By optimizing your website for mobile devices, you can improve your local SEO and attract more local customers to your business.
